Output 75366d2caf7a877d9fa0bdc890fe9fcd2d92b48ba62ac638387f6804ebc260fa:1

value
8296860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d692654082a3ecc5efbda85afec19a00a4e49fe OP_EQUAL
address
3BfXYPDcnVi8ZjcJSbbjMGnzviN8NVHS88
transaction
75366d2caf7a877d9fa0bdc890fe9fcd2d92b48ba62ac638387f6804ebc260fa
spent
true